Output 0d8327a694de59ddeebf707963c1c3681c316e0f646945ab6992f0fa2b809fd0:2

value
1670679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ab8b7fdb088bace2904a071be1060b002a10431 OP_EQUAL
address
32fhxwfivmVmVMzBXhqPieTdDE9W9j8oyr
transaction
0d8327a694de59ddeebf707963c1c3681c316e0f646945ab6992f0fa2b809fd0
confirmations
99298
spent
true